Biography

Councilmember Leslie Cornejo was elected in 2020 and is serving her first term on the City Council. She was elected to serve as Vice Mayor for 2023.

Business

Cornejo has owned and operated Santa Paula Travel Service, a full service, retail travel agency on Main Street since 1988.  She was a founding director of Santa Clara Valley Bank, and served as Chairman of the Board through the merger with Bank of the Sierra.

Education

BA in Spanish/ESL Bilingual Education from UC Irvine. Being fluent in Spanish allows her to communicate with and serve the entire community.  She has also studied in Costa Rica and Mexico.

Community Service

Leslie has been a director of the Ventura County Fairgrounds since 2008, serving as board president for 5 of those years.  She was active in Soroptimist Int’l. of Santa Paula for 15 years, 1st Vice President of the Santa Paula Police and Fire Foundation and co-chaired the Moonlight at the Ranch event for three years, which netted about $40,000 a year for the foundation.  

Priorities

Cornejo brings business acumen and corporate governance experience to the city council, and hopes to assist an already excellent city organization to improve services to Santa Paula residents.  She strongly supports public safety agencies and wishes to improve their ability to keep the community safe.  Her focus is on improving the business environment and grow the tax base in order to achieve these goals and improve the quality of life for Santa Paulans.

Personal

Leslie and husband Enrique, an immigrant from Chile have three sons and five grandchildren, all of who live along the Central Coast.  She has traveled to over 60 countries and loves organizing and hosting groups to new destinations.
